Filing nails from the corners to the center helps create a smooth, even shape while preventing snagging or splitting. This technique reduces stress on the nail edges, allowing for a healthier nail structure. Additionally, it promotes a more polished appearance, enhancing the overall look of your manicure. Proper filing technique also minimizes the risk of injury or damage to the surrounding skin.

Filing from the corners to the center of the nail helps maintain the nail's natural shape and prevents breakage. This technique reduces the risk of splitting or chipping by keeping the edges smooth and even. Additionally, it allows for better control, leading to a more polished and professional finish. Overall, it promotes healthier nails and enhances their appearance.
